Getting To and From SNA: Seamless Connections
One of the biggest advantages of flying into or out of Newport Beach Airport is the ease of ground transportation. Getting to and from SNA is incredibly convenient, thanks to its central location and the variety of options available. Taxis and rideshare services (like Uber and Lyft) are readily available outside the terminals, providing quick and direct transport to your final destination. If you prefer to drive yourself, there are several parking options, ranging from short-term to long-term, including economy lots that offer shuttle services. Rental car facilities are also conveniently located, offering a wide selection of vehicles to suit your needs. For those using public transportation, there are bus routes that connect SNA to various parts of Orange County, offering a more budget-friendly option. The proximity to major freeways, including the 405 and 55, means that even if your destination is a bit further out, you can reach it efficiently. Airlines and Destinations: Your Route to the West Coast and Beyond
Newport Beach Airport, officially known as John Wayne Airport (SNA), serves a range of major and regional airlines, connecting you to numerous destinations across the United States. You'll find carriers like American Airlines, Delta Air Lines, Southwest Airlines, and United Airlines operating out of SNA, offering a good selection of flights. While SNA primarily focuses on domestic routes, these airlines provide connections to major hubs, allowing you to reach virtually anywhere in the world. Popular destinations from SNA include cities like Seattle, Denver, Phoenix, Las Vegas, San Francisco, and Portland, making it easy to hop around the West Coast. For those traveling further afield, connecting through these hubs offers endless possibilities. The flight schedules are designed to accommodate various travel needs, whether you're looking for early morning departures or late-night arrivals. It's worth checking the airport's official website or your preferred airline's site for the most up-to-date information on routes and schedules, as they can change seasonally.
